    Enzo Maresca, from Salerno to the roof of the world with Chelsea

    Being curious, experiencing things with passion and always wanting to learn. This is Enzo Maresca's secret to succeeding in sport and in life. In the Philharmonic Hall, the Chelsea coach, who in his first experience with the blues immediately won the Conference League and the World Club Championship, snatching it from Paris Saint Germain, the team favoured by all the bookmakers. A globetrotting footballer, with experience in England, Spain and Greece, as a coach he grew up in Josep Guardiola's 'workshop', but it was Manuel Pellegrini who was his first mentor at West Ham.

    Häkkinen and Jacques Villeneuve: Formula 1: 'We used to need the handle, now it's all driving simulators and computers'

    At the Trento Sports Festival, the spotlight is on the combination of passion and daring that unites generations and disciplines: from the Formula 1 track to the individual challenges that shape champions. In a context where sport becomes tale and myth, two names emerge with opposite but complementary force: Mika Häkkinen and Jacques Villeneuve. Through their stories - of triumphs, risks and character - not only the spectacle of speed is told, but also the human face that beats behind the helmet. The occasion is the 75th anniversary of Formula 1, celebrated in Trento. The moral, anticipated by the two former champions, goes like this: today computers and simulators count more, in our time the handle counted more.
    Mika Häkkinen, the 'Flying Finn', twice world champion with McLaren in 1998 and 1999, remains one of the symbols of Formula 1 in its golden years: pure talent, glacial control and that rare ability to turn speed into an elegant gesture. Next to him, another name that evokes a legendary dynasty: Jacques Villeneuve, Canadian, son of the unforgettable Gilles. World Champion in 1997 with Williams, he ideally closed the circle of a family history marked by courage. A restless and unconventional driver, he travelled through Formula 1 with the same free spirit that later led him to music and the commentary microphones from the trackside.

    Freediving legends Pipin Ferreras and Umberto Pelizzari: a record-breaking competition

    The historic rivalry that gave rise to alternating challenges to conquer world records in various disciplines in the 1990s is what most characterises these two freediving legends: Pipin Ferreras and Umberto Pelizzari. One of the most iconic competitions in the history of the sport, which pushed the two athletes further and further down, reaching incredible depths. At the end of their respective competitive careers, they both embarked on paths related to teaching, making their extraordinary experience available to new freedivers. Pelizzari also created his 'Apnea Academy' to pass on his knowledge to anyone wishing to explore the world of freediving at a high level.

    Blackboard, dialogue and planning: the Benítez method

    He won over the Festival audience Rafael Benítez. He did it with competence, sympathy and empathy. And how can you fail to applaud a coach who knows how to talk about technique, cups and clubs without ever forgetting the human side of sport? A cocktail of competence and Mediterranean warmth that works on the pitch but also off it. And that it works on the pitch, the football almanacs say so: the 'King of Cups' boasts 13 titles won in 3 countries and with 6 different teams. A very long career, that of Benítez, which started at the age of twenty-six with Real Madrid's youth team in 1986. Successes in half of Europe, among them the Champions League with Liverpool. Then two Uefa Cups with Valencia and Chelsea and two La Liga titles, again with Valencia. In Italy he won the Italian Super Cup with Inter in 2010 and then, in 2014, the Super Cup and Coppa Italia with Napoli.

    Kelly Doualla, the young 'child of the wind'

    An emerging talent in athletics, Kelly Doualla is a young Italian sprinter, born in Pavia in 2009 to parents from Cameroon, with whom she lives in Sant'Angelo Lodigiano. A gold medallist in the 100 metres at the European Under-20 Championships in Tampere, Finland, in 2025, she became the youngest ever winner over the distance, entering the history of European athletics at just 15 years and 261 days old. Thus came the definitive consecration: Kelly Doualla is now considered one of the most promising Italian sprinters. On her debut in blue at the European Youth Olympic Festival 2025, she set a new European U18 record in the 100 metres, rewriting the best youth times in Italy. The best performances in the category, both U18 and U20, at national level were already hers before that 11.21 with which she took the continental record. "I knew I could do well but I could do better," said the speedy champion at the Trento Sports Festival, in a talk entitled "The daughter of the wind", an honorary reference to the legend Carl Lewis, in a pressing but fresh and at times hilarious dialogue with Chiara Soldi, a journalist from the Gazzetta dello Sport.

    Larissa Iapichino: transforming disappointments into energy to face the future

    React, turn despondency into energy to become even stronger and face the future head-on. The recipe of Larissa Iapichino, long jumper of the Italian national team, is simple on paper, but to write it, the 23-year-old Florentine had to go through two big disappointments first at the 2025 Olympics and then at the World Championships last September. A fourth place and an elimination in the preliminaries that hurt a lot, but that did not spoil an otherwise very good season that saw Larissa win the European Indoor Championships and the Diamond League for the second time and, finally, exceed seven metres (7.06) for the first time in her career.

    Kolo Touré and the Arsenal of the invincibles: 'Strong because we were like brothers on the pitch'

    From the pitch to the player management control room: the Trento Sports Festival hosted Kolo Touré, a pillar of the 'invincible' defences in the Premier League, and Maheta Molango, a lawyer and CEO who represents the collective voice of footballers today. One has experienced football from the pitch, the other works behind the scenes to transform it: together they embody the present - and the future - of power in football. Touré, former Arsenal, Manchester City and Liverpool, twice African champion with the Ivory Coast, brought charisma and tactical rigour to the pitch. Molango, Swiss-Congolese, former striker and now chief executive of the PFA (Professional Footballers' Association), is the new figurehead of the English footballers' union, between rights, ethics and the future of the game.
